Public bug reported:

I'm using Ubuntu 13.04 dev with firefox 18.0~b5+build1-0ubuntu1 and
firefox-locale-de 18.0~b5+build1-0ubuntu1. On deleting (or renaming) the
old profile and creating a new one Firefox uses still the english
language pack. A workaround to solve this is to disable and enable the
german language pack and to restart Firefox.
